2. Programmable Button
The RIFFMASTER Wireless Guitar Controller has a user-mappable button called "P1".
By default, the P1 button is mapped to R3.
a)
To program the P1 button, hold the "Function" button then press and release the P1 button.
b)
Once the LED is flashing, press any button on the guitar to map that button's function to the P1 button. The LED will
c)
blink quickly 3 times indicating successful programming.
To reset the P1 button to its default R3, press and hold the "Function" button then press the P1 button twice.
d)
3. Battery Charging
The RIFFMASTER Wireless Guitar Controller includes a built-in, rechargeable Lithium-Ion battery with up to 36-hours of play time
per charge.
To recharge your guitar, connect the included USB-C cable to the USB-C port on the guitar, and the other end into the
a)
USB port of your PS5® console or PS4™ console.
The white status LED on the guitar will light up and begin fading in/out to indicate that it is charging.
b)
Once fully charged, the white status LED on the guitar will turn solid and no longer flash to indicate the battery is full.
c)
When your guitar reaches a low-battery level, the white status LED on the guitar will begin flashing quickly provide a low
d)
battery warning.
When the battery level is critically low and will turn off soon, an audible warning tone will play every minute through a
e)
connected headset.
